The summer visited started with a trip to Kew. A week or so later, on another sunny day, a few committee members manned a stall at fundraising event in Kimbolton for Macmillan Cancer Care. The club raffled flower arrangements by committee members and raised a tidy contribution. The summer also involved an evening outing to Docwra's Manor, Royston, which two days later was followed by a garden lunch in aid of the East Anglian Air Ambulance.
The club is now looking forward to the next meeting on September 18 at 7.30pm in Mandeville Hall, Kimbolton, when Pat Billing will give her interpretation of Colour at my Fingertips. The cost to non members is £4 or you can join the club for the next six months for £10.
